In this workshop series we’ll gather to explore and share the [virtual] shelter
of each other during this time of physical social distancing.

Come when you are able to for this free weekly online journaling circle on Tuesday mornings 10-11am AEST.

I’ll offer gentle guided writing exercises using simple prompts and poems to help you get started in your journal writing experience.

In each session, there’ll be quiet time for writing whatever comes to mind.

There is no requirement to share your writing in this group and no particular writing skills are needed. Just a pen & paper or keyboard and the desire to keep some kind of journal.

Running every Tuesday … until we come out of Covid physical distancing.

Journal writing…

…is good for our health, increases our self-awareness and helps keep us grounded, grateful and present to the life we are living.  

…helps us solve problems, make decisions, gain clarity, cope with grief and loss and thrive during times of transition or confusion. 

A journal is like a trusted friend & attentive listener.
